GAELTACHT LONDAN:

A SUMMER SCHOOL WITH A DIFFERENCE

26 May 2010

Can’t afford the trip to Connemara for the holidays? Don’t worry, because at the end of June, the Gaeltacht comes to Camden Square courtesy of Dr. Séamus Ó Diollúinn.

Séamus is clearly looking forward to running this event: “This summer school promises to be an exciting mix of language, culture and literature,” he says.

“It aims to give participants a carefully chosen but enjoyable taste of all aspects of the Irish language tradition,” explains Séamus, who has taught at St. Patrick's College Drumcondra, University of Limerick, and Mary Immaculate College, Limerick.

The Gaeltacht Londan experience certainly offers a comprehensive array of activities; from basic necessities like ordering your drinks as Gaeilge, right through to loftier matters such as writing Irish love poetry.

Along the way, there are workshops on place and surnames, seminars on the Irish language outside Ireland as well as Gaelic games, céilís and trad sessions in the evenings.

It’s safe to say that this will be a week where participants are completely immersed in Irish language and culture. Séamus maintains that “at the end of the school, participants will be able to communicate in Irish on everyday topics like talking about the weather, chatting in the pub, booking a holiday in Ireland.”

Who knows? It might even be the start of a new London-Irish dialect: blas na Londaine innit?

Gaeltacht Londan runs from June 28 to July 2
